Pamela's Gluten-Free Waffles

How I make them great every day

If you are looking for a gluten-free breakfast option, waffles made with Pamela's Gluten-Free Baking and Pancake Mix are a great choice. This mix is specially formulated to give you the perfect texture and taste for your waffles. Here is a simple recipe to make delicious gluten-free waffles using Pamela's mix.

Pamela Gluten Free

This is how I make my daughter's waffles - just about every morning.

Ingredients

  • 1 1/2 cups Pamela's Gluten-Free Baking and Pancake Mix
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/4 cups water
  • 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Directions

  1. Preheat your waffle maker.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the Pamela's Gluten-Free Baking and Pancake Mix and eggs.
  3. Add the water,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ract to the bowl and whisk until the batter is smooth.
  4. Pour the batter onto the preheated waffle maker and cook until the waffles are golden brown and crispy.
  5. Serve the waffles with your favorite toppings such as fresh fruit, whipped cream, or syrup.

Making gluten-free waffles with Pamela's Gluten-Free Baking and Pancake Mix is easy and delicious. Enjoy a gluten-free breakfast with this simple recipe.
